Newcastle United, a team of mid - upper strength in the Premier League, had an under - par performance last season, finishing 12th. However, they've shown a fresh look at the start of this new Premier League campaign. In the first round, they held Liverpool to a 2 - 2 draw at home, and in the second round, they convincingly defeated Tottenham 2 - 0 away. Both Elanga and Vissa have been in excellent form. The team is now playing at home and is hungry for victory. Nevertheless, their recent home record isn't very impressive. They've only managed 1 win, 2 draws, and 2 losses in their last 5 home matches. As a result, there isn't much hype around the home - team, and the support for them is relatively weak.

      The Premier League (Gameweek 3) fixture between Newcastle United and AFC Bournemouth takes place today, September 5, 2026, at St. James' Park. Match Analysis & H2H Context • AFC Bournemouth Form & Tactical Setup: Bournemouth enter Gameweek 3 looking to build on early consistency. Despite facing tough opening tests—a 2–1 loss at Manchester City and a 1–1 draw against Everton—the Cherries remain tactically resilient. Led by Alex Scott in midfield and Marcus Tavernier alongside Evanilson up front, Bournemouth excel in high-intensity pressing and quick transition setups on the road. • Newcastle United Form: Matthias Jaissle's Newcastle have enjoyed an encouraging start, remaining unbeaten in three matches across all competitions (2W, 1D). Following a thrilling 2–2 draw with Liverpool and a impressive 2–0 away victory over Tottenham Hotspur, Newcastle generate high attacking volume at home through Yoane Wissa and Anthony Elanga.

      Newcastle enter Gameweek 3 of the 2026/27 Premier League season with four points from two matches and sit sixth. They drew 2-2 with Liverpool before beating Tottenham 2-0, showing that Matthias Jaissle’s new system has adapted quickly despite major squad changes. Bournemouth have one point and sit 14th. They lost 2-1 to Manchester City in the opening round before drawing 1-1 with Everton. Marco Rose’s side can still generate pressure, but their ability to protect a lead remains a concern. Recent meetings favor Bournemouth. Last season, they won 2-1 at St James’ Park while the reverse fixture ended 0-0 at the Vitality Stadium. The teams also drew 3-3 in the FA Cup before Newcastle advanced on penalties. Over a longer period, Newcastle finished seventh in 2023/24 with 60 points, fifth in 2024/25 with 66 points, before falling to 12th in 2025/26.
